Czech Films 2012–2013 2013 / Kdekoli jinde / Czech Republic, USA 2012

Taxi driver Tesfai’s ex-wife is on her second honeymoon, so maybe this is a good opportunity for him to improve relations with his teenage kids. This sensitive, medium-length movie, introducing completely normal yet highly appealing characters, was awarded Best Feature Film at Prague’s Famufest in 2012.

Anywhere Else Anywhere Else

Synopsis

Tesfai works as a taxi driver even though it’s clear that neither he nor his kids are any too happy about it. His ex-wife, who lives in the house with the family, is on her honeymoon, which provides Tesfai with an opportunity to get to know his children better. This story isn’t burdened by hastily concocted dramas, offering instead an atmosphere of quiet anticipation that betrays a wealth of information about its charming, decent characters. This neatly constructed movie sensitively handles the topic of foreigners established in the United States who are still seeking some kind of fulfilment.

About the director

Asmara Marek

Asmara Beraki was born in San Francisco but grew up in Washington DC. Her father’s Eritrean origins inspired her to make Anywhere Else, her graduation film from Prague’s Film Academy (FAMU). After the picture won Best Feature Film at FAMUFest in 2012, she began teaching short film direction at the Academy. Her feature debut The Narcissists is currently in preproduction and will be shot in Prague and New York.
